However, there are areas where caution is required. While the design is robust, it might struggle in applications requiring extremely fine detail, such as tiny stickers under one inch in diameter. Complex layouts where this graphic competes with heavy text blocks could also dilute its impact. If you are creating packaging design or labels, ensure the resolution is sufficient for the print size you intend to use. For Cricut users, always inspect the cut lines in your software before sending the job to the machine; sometimes, intricate curves in trendy typography-style graphics need slight node editing to ensure a clean weed. Additionally, avoid placing this graphic on busy patterns where the edges might get lost, compromising the brand identity you are trying to establish.
Practical execution is where many sellers fail, so here are my notes for integrating this file into your workflow. First, remember that when you acquire this asset, it arrives as a compressed archive. You will need to extract the contents from the zip folder to access the individual vector and raster files. Once unzipped, organize them clearly in your asset library. Before listing anything for sale, test the design on actual physical mockups. Print it on transfer paper, sublimate it on a blank mug, or cut it from vinyl. Check how the colors render in both CMYK and RGB spaces. Verify that the PNG transparency is flawless, with no unwanted white halos around the text or graphics.
Typography pairing is another critical consideration. Since the main graphic likely features a distinct font style, complement it with a simple sans serif font for informational text or a delicate script font for added flair in your marketing materials. Avoid clashing it with overly ornate display fonts that might fight for attention. If you plan to sell finished products, you must confirm the commercial license terms associated with the download. Ensure you are allowed to sell physical end-products like shirts and mugs, as some licenses restrict usage to personal projects only.
